Estudio Tolentino & Asociados is a Peruvian firm of attorneys and accountants with more than a decade in the market. We advise companies and individuals on tax, customs, accounting, financial, labor, corporate, civil and criminal matters.

A firm that does not separate legal from accounting work
We were founded in 2013 with a simple conviction: the problems of a Peruvian company are rarely only legal or only accounting problems. A tax audit is won or lost in the accounting records. A poorly documented dismissal becomes a labor exposure and a tax adjustment at the same time. A corporate reorganization that is well thought out in legal terms can prove costly if no one measured its tax effect.
That is why we work with a multidisciplinary team of attorneys and accountants who review the same file from both sides. The client does not have to translate between their attorney and their accountant, or take the risk that neither of them sees the whole problem.
We serve clients from our offices in Miraflores, in Lima, and in Chilca, in Cañete: micro and small businesses, growing companies, importers and exporters, and individuals with tax, civil, inheritance, or criminal matters.

Carlos José Tolentino Béjar
Attorney and Certified Public Accountant, with more than fifteen years of experience in taxation, accounting, auditing, and corporate legal advisory.
He has conducted tax litigation proceedings before SUNAT, the Tax Court (Tribunal Fiscal) and the Judiciary, and has managed more than S/ 200 million in refund claims for exporter credit balances, income tax and other taxes, for exporting, industrial and commercial companies.
He is the founder and director of the Peruvian Institute of Business Law and Management (Instituto Peruano de Derecho y Gestión Empresarial, IPDGE).
